What is Repeated Implantation Failure?

Repeated implantation failure refers to a condition where embryos fail to implant in the uterus after several IVF attempts. While definitions vary among fertility specialists, it is commonly diagnosed when:

  • Three or more embryo transfers fail
  • High-quality embryos are transferred but pregnancy does not occur
  • No clear cause is identified through routine testing

Common Causes of Repeated Implantation Failure

Embryo Genetic Abnormalities

Chromosomal abnormalities are one of the most common causes of implantation failure.

Uterine Abnormalities

Structural conditions like fibroids, polyps, or scar tissue may prevent embryo attachment.

Endometrial Receptivity Issues

The uterine lining may not be receptive at the time of embryo transfer.

Immune System Factors

Immune responses may interfere with embryo implantation.

Hormonal Imbalances

Hormones such as progesterone must be properly regulated for successful implantation.

Male Factor Infertility

Sperm DNA fragmentation may affect embryo development.

Treatment Strategies

  • Personalized embryo transfer timing
  • Genetic embryo screening
  • Treatment of uterine abnormalities
  • Hormonal therapy adjustments
  • Immune system treatment
